Rio Tinto CEO and other top executives to step down after Australia cave blast review.
Rio Tinto said on Friday its chief executive would step down in the wake of mounting dissatisfaction over the findings of an internal review into how the miner legally destroyed historically significant Aboriginal rockshelters.

Chris Salisbury will step down as chief executive of the iron ore division with immediate effect and leave Rio Tinto on Dec. 31, the company said, while Simone Niven would step down as group executive of corporate relations.
